JC track and field: OCC’s Icban incredible
- Share via
SANTA BARBARA - Two state crowns.
Not a bad weekend’s work for Orange Coast College athlete Michelle
Icban, who captured two titles at the California Community College Track
and Field Finals in Santa Barbara held Friday and Saturday.
Icban finished first in both the 5,000 meters (17:40.64) and the
10,000 (36:42.42).
OCC’s Jennifer Finaldi soared 11-6 to become the state champion in the
pole vault at the weekend competition. Her mark is also a school record.
OCC’s Lindsay Allen finished third in the 3,000 steeplechase
(11:19.22). She also went 18:46.83 to finish seventh in the 5,000.
Ginger Liechtly cleared 5-0 to finish seventh in the high jump, while
Julie Kroening was eighth in the 400 hurdles in 1:07.32.
OCC was fifth as a team with 40.5 points, while Mt. SAC finished first
with 97.
